Let’s be real—there’s no such thing as zero crying during sleep training. I mean, toddlers cry if we give them the wrong color cup, so of course a new bedtime routine gets some pushback. Even with gentle sleep training methods for babies, some tears are expected as your child learns new routines and expectations.
Crying is a baby’s way of communicating change and processing new routines. When your baby or toddler is accustomed to falling asleep a certain way, they’ve been trained to fall asleep a certain way. They think they NEED that way to fall or go to sleep. Have you done anything wrong?! NO! We do what we need to early on to get rest. Simply put, what you’re doing now is no longer working for you… and that’s okay! What I can assure you of is that I require parents to respond when their baby cries. I will teach you a different way to respond every time your child cries.
